Our guest today is Joakim Achrén, a gaming industry veteran with a remarkable journey. He's the Founder of Elite Game Developers and General Partner at F4 Fund. Earlier, Joakim co-founded Next Games, which was later acquired by Netflix. With a ton of experience as both an operator and investor in the gaming world, Joakim has unique insights to share.
